/**
 * This is the base class for a dialog box with a tree on the left hand side and
 * pages for each node on the right. It takes a model object in the constructor
 * and maintains a reference to this object. The pages can retrieve this model
 * object by calling the {@link #getModel() getModel}method. It defines two
 * abstract methods {@link #performCancel() performCancel}and
 * {@link #performOk() performOk}. These methods are called when the user
 * presses the ok or cancel button. <br/>
 * <br/>
 * 
 * Pages can be added to this by either calling the
 * {@link #addNodeTo(String, PropertyNode) addNodeTo}method or by calling the
 * {@link #addPageTo(String, String, String, Image, IPropertyPage) addPageTo}
 * method.
 * 
 * @version $Revision: 1.19.6.1 $ $Date: 2011/04/02 07:27:08 $
 */

public abstract class AbstractPropertyDialog extends BaseDialog
        implements IPropertyPageContainer, IPageChangeProvider {

    private static final String SASHFORM_RIGHT = "SASHFORM.RIGHT"; //$NON-NLS-1$

    private static final String SASHFORM_LEFT = "SASHFORM.LEFT"; //$NON-NLS-1$

    private transient Object modelObject = null;

    protected transient PropertyNode rootNode = null;

    private transient StackLayout propertyPaneLayout = null;

    private transient Composite propertyPane = null;

    private transient PropertyNode currentNode = null;

    private transient boolean processSelection = true;

    private transient Label titleImage = null;

    protected TreeViewer viewer = null;

    private DialogMessageArea messageArea = null;

    private String nodeId;

    protected boolean showPage = false;

    private int[] widthHints = new int[2];

    private Control treeViewer;

    private Control pageContainer;

    private Composite container;

    private ListenerList pageChangedListeners = new ListenerList();

    /**
     * The only constructor for this dialog. It takes the parentShell and the
     * model object as parameters.
     * 
     * @param parentShell
     *            The parent shell
     * @param model
     *            The model object that the dialog pages will interact with.
     */
    public AbstractPropertyDialog(Shell parentShell, Object model) {
        super(parentShell, ""); //$NON-NLS-1$
        setModel(model);
        setShellStyle(getShellStyle() | SWT.RESIZE | SWT.MAX);
        propertyPaneLayout = new StackLayout();
        rootNode = new PropertyNode(
                "org.eclipse.birt.report.designer.ui.dialogs.properties.propertydialog.rootnode"); //$NON-NLS-1$
    }

    /*
     * (non-Javadoc)
     * 
     * @see
     * org.eclipse.birt.report.designer.ui.IPropertyPageContainer#setModel(java
     * .lang.Object)
     */
    public void setModel(Object model) {
        modelObject = model;
    }

    /*
     * (non-Javadoc)
     * 
     * @see
     * org.eclipse.birt.report.designer.ui.IPropertyPageContainer#getModel()
     */
    public final Object getModel() {
        return modelObject;
    }

    /**
     * Adds a node to the dialog at the specified path The path needs to point
     * to an existing node or to the root element. The path elements are
     * separated by the "/" character. If the path is null then the node is just
     * added to the root. For e.g. In order to create the following tree
     * structure: <br/>
     * 
     * <pre>
     * 
     * 
     * 
     * 
     * 
     *           Prop1
     *           |_
     *             Prop2
     * 
     * 
     * 
     * 
     * 
     * </pre>
     * 
     * <br/>
     * The api needs to be called as follows: <br/>
     * <code>
     *  addNodeTo("/", Prop1Node);<br/>
     *  addNodeTo("/Prop1", Prop2Node);<br/>
     * </code> Prop1 and Prop2 being the node ids of the respective nodes.
     * 
     * @param path
     *            The path under which the new node is to be added.
     * @param node
     *            The node to be added.
     */
    public final void addNodeTo(String path, PropertyNode node) {
        node.setContainer(this);
        if (path == null || path.trim().equals("/")) //$NON-NLS-1$
        {
            rootNode.add(node);
        } else {
            PropertyNode parentNode = getNode(path);
            if (parentNode != null) {
                parentNode.add(node);
            }
        }
    }

    /**
     * This is a convenience method that can be used to add the PropertyPage to
     * the dialog. In turn it creates a PropertyNode object and calls the
     * {@link #addNodeTo(String, PropertyNode) addNodeTo}method.
     * 
     * @param path
     *            The path under which the new page is to be added.
     * @param nodeId
     *            The unique id to be assigned to the node
     * @param nodeLabel
     *            The label for the node, If this is null then the page name is
     *            used
     * @param nodeImage
     *            The image for the node if any. If this is null then the image
     *            returned by the page is used
     * @param page
     *            The page to be added to the dialog.
     */
    public final void addPageTo(String path, String nodeId, String nodeLabel, Image nodeImage, IPropertyPage page) {
        PropertyNode node = new PropertyNode(nodeId, nodeLabel, nodeImage, page);
        addNodeTo(path, node);
    }

    /**
     * Looks up the node based on the path it is givean
     * 
     * @param path
     *            The complete path to the target node.
     * @return The Node object or null if it is not found.
     */
    private final PropertyNode getNode(String path) {
        PropertyNode currentNode = null;
        if (path != null) {
            path = path.trim();
            currentNode = rootNode;
            StringTokenizer tokenizer = new StringTokenizer(path, "/"); //$NON-NLS-1$
            while (tokenizer.hasMoreTokens()) {
                currentNode = currentNode.getSubNode(tokenizer.nextToken());
                if (currentNode == null) {
                    return null;
                }
            }

        }
        return currentNode;
    }

    /**
     * Called when the user pressed the Ok button. It is called only if all the
     * pages return true for their individual
     * {@link org.eclipse.birt.report.designer.data.ui.property.IPropertyPage#performOk()
     * performOk} methods. Derived classes can save the contents of the dialog
     * and perform any validation if necessary on the contents. <br/>
     * The dialog is closed if this method returns true.
     * 
     * @return boolean indicating whether the method was successful or not.
     */
    public abstract boolean performOk();

    /**
     * Called when the user presses the Cancel button. It is called only if all
     * the pages return true for their individual
     * {@link org.eclipse.birt.report.designer.data.ui.property.IPropertyPage#performCancel()
     * performCancel()} methods. <br/>
     * The dialog is closed if this method returns true.
     * 
     * @return boolean indicating whether the method was successful or not.
     */
    public abstract boolean performCancel();

    private final void performHelp() {
        // Call the perform help of the current page
        if (currentNode != null) {
            currentNode.getPageControl().notifyListeners(SWT.Help, new Event());
        }
    }

    /*
     * (non-Javadoc)
     * 
     * @see org.eclipse.jface.dialogs.Dialog#cancelPressed()
     */
    protected final void cancelPressed() {
        // First call cancel on all the pages
        if (rootNode.hasSubNodes()) {
            PropertyNode[] nodes = rootNode.getSubNodes();
            for (int n = 0; n < nodes.length; n++) {
                // Check whether the current page can be cancelled
                if (!cancelPressed(nodes[n])) {
                    return;
                }
            }
        }

        // Finally call it on the dialog
        if (performCancel()) {
            super.cancelPressed();
        }
    }

    private final boolean cancelPressed(PropertyNode node) {
        if (node.getPage().performCancel()) {
            // if this node allows performing the cancel operation
            // check the child nodes
            if (node.hasSubNodes()) {
                PropertyNode[] nodes = node.getSubNodes();
                for (int n = 0; n < nodes.length; n++) {
                    // Check whether the current page can be cancelled
                    if (!cancelPressed(nodes[n])) {
                        return false;
                    }
                }
            }
            // If we have come here then we know that all the nodes have
            // successfully allowed cancelling
            return true;
        }
        return false;
    }

    /*
     * (non-Javadoc)
     * 
     * @see org.eclipse.jface.dialogs.Dialog#okPressed()
     */
    protected void okPressed() {
        if (currentNode != null) {
            if (!okPressed(currentNode))
                return;
        }
        // First call ok on all the pages
        if (rootNode.hasSubNodes()) {
            PropertyNode[] nodes = rootNode.getSubNodes();
            for (int n = 0; n < nodes.length; n++) {
                // Check whether the current page can be closed
                if (nodes[n] != currentNode && (!okPressed(nodes[n]))) {
                    return;
                }
            }
        }
        // Finally call it on the dialog
        if (performOk()) {
            super.okPressed();
        }
    }

    private final boolean okPressed(PropertyNode node) {
        if (node.getPage().performOk()) {
            // if this node allows performing the cancel operation
            // check the child nodes
            if (node.hasSubNodes()) {
                PropertyNode[] nodes = node.getSubNodes();
                for (int n = 0; n < nodes.length; n++) {
                    // Check whether the current page can be cancelled
                    if (!okPressed(nodes[n])) {
                        return false;
                    }
                }
            }
            // If we have come here then we know that all the nodes have
            // successfully allowed cancelling
            return true;
        }
        return false;
    }
